Campus Life
Living on campus is a proven way for students to succeed academically, connect with
their peers and engage with campus life. That’s why the 911±¬ÁÏ
requires that all first-year students live on campus.
Fun fact: 911±¬ÁÏ’s residence halls are the only ones in the nation to boast a view of
the 911±¬ÁÏ Range and Denali — the highest peak in North America.

FERPA for Families
The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A) protects the education records of students, affording them rights of privacy and control over their educational records. FERPA covers any records that a university keeps that are directly related to a student. This includes their grades, class registrations, student bill, campus housing records, disciplinary records and almost everything that contains personally identifiable information. This even includes their student status with 911±¬ÁÏ â€” whether or not they are even currently a 911±¬ÁÏ student is protected by FERPA.
